    Hyundai is on a roll in general, and last week we published the first 2011 Hyundai Sonata Hybrid drive report, by our colleague Marty Padgett. This very important model is the carmaker's first-ever hybrid to be sold in the U.S., but far from the last.  In 2012, Hyundai plans an upcoming dedicated hybrid that shares no body panels with any other model. The 2011 Sonata Hybrid may hit 40 miles per gallon for highway mileage in final EPA testing, says Hyundai CEO John Krafcik.
